    Geeta Bali (born Harkirtan Kaur; 1930 ‒ 21 January 1965) was an Indian actress who worked in Hindi films. Bali is regarded among the finest actresses in the history of Indian cinema , [ 3 ] Bali acted in over 75 films in a career spanning over two decades.

    Jai Jai Jai Bajrang Bali (transl. Victory to the mighty Hanuman) is an Indian Hindu religious television series, which premiered on 6 June 2011 on Sahara One. It is based on the life of Hanuman , the Hindu vanara deity who plays a major role in the epic Ramayana .
